Donald Trump has once again announced he would urge FIFA to relocate upcoming World Cup matches from a venue based on municipal politics, with the Boston region now being the third targeted location to face such statements from the White House. Additionally, Trump suggested he would contemplate similar action against LA for the 2028 Summer Games due to potential public safety risks.
Even though Trump does not have official jurisdiction to unilaterally remove either competition, he can exert influence the respective governing bodies overseeing each tournament to move host cities.
These remarks were made during a press event with Javier Milei, who was visiting the executive mansion following the disclosure of a massive bailout for the Latin American country. At the close of the gathering, a media member inquired Trump about a latest âstreet takeoverâ in downtown Boston where authorities were targeted and a patrol car was ignited. The correspondent also questioned if such events could cause the revocation of tournament responsibilities for the 48-team soccer tournament.
âWe could take them away,â Trump said regarding the FIFA World Cup fixtures, scheduled to be staged at the Massachusetts arena. âThe city's leader is not good ⌠she is radical left, and theyâre occupying parts of downtown. It's a major statement, don't you think?â
Public disruptions, a online-fueled phenomenon where participants assemble on public avenues after dark to conduct vehicular acrobatics, have become a repeated nuisance in American cities since the Covid-19 pandemic restrictions. Latest incidents have escalated into violence in Massachusetts, notably in downtown. Yet, these occurrences are generally not considered linked to any specific ideological group.
âIn cases where someone is failing, and I perceive there are security risks, I'd call Gianni [Infantino], who is phenomenal, and say letâs move it to another location,â the former president stated publicly. âHe'd do that. He wouldnât love to do it, but he would comply. Very easily, he would.â
Gianni Infantino has been open his attempts to be closely connected with Trump before the upcoming World Cup, scheduled to be organized in numerous American venues across the America along with a couple in the northern neighbor and three in the southern neighbor. The organization's leader has been present at several White House gatherings, arranged for Trump hand over the Club World Cup award after the championship match, and has even rescheduled his the group's assembly to accompany Trump on a trip to the Arab region earlier in 2025.

On September 25, the Washington city and San Francisco faced comparable comments, with Trump asserting both urban centers were âled by far-left extremists who donât know what they're managing,â while questioning the safety level of both locales and suggesting that matches could be shifted.
Victor Montagliani rejected Trumpâs statements when he responded days later at a event in the UK capital.
âItâs the organization's event, our responsibility, FIFA makes those decisions,â the vice-president declared. âPolitely to current world leaders, football is more important than them and the game will survive their tenure and their leadership. Thatâs the strength of football, that it is bigger than one leader and bigger than any country.â
During the event, Trumpâs response to a query about the Massachusetts city extended to a comparable warning regarding the 2028 Los Angeles Olympics.
âIn case I believed LA was not prepared properly, I will shift it to a different city as needed,â Trump stated. âOn that one I might have to obtain a different kind of permission, but we'd do that.â
The permission Trump alluded to would have to come from the International Olympic Committee (IOC). Their president, the newly elected president, was chosen to her position in spring and has yet to appear together with him, but she stated that she would like a sit-down with him at a future time.
Trump also criticized California governor Newsomâs response of this yearâs LA wildfires, stating that a similar situation could result in the relocation of the Olympics.
âIn case the governor is uncooperative, we will have to be firm,â Trump said.
The warning was equally direct for the Massachusetts city.
âThe city must address these issues,â Trump stated. âThatâs all I will say.â
